The primary stop is in the Annapurna region, renowned for its dramatic mountain scenery and accessible trekking routes. The tour typically involves an 8-hour day hike, which can be customized based on your fitness level and interests.
Starting from Pokhara, your trek will lead through beautiful landscapes, with stops in local villages like Dhampus or other scenic spots such as the Australian Camp. You’ll get to see the Himalayas up close and experience Nepali mountain life firsthand. You can expect a mix of challenging and relaxing moments — walking through forests, crossing small suspension bridges, and pausing in charming villages. The routes are designed to showcase the best views with manageable walking distances, making this suitable for many levels of fitness.
Local food stops are a highlight. While the tour fee covers the guide’s meals, you may want to indulge in traditional Nepali dishes like momos or dal bhat. The scenery combined with these authentic flavors creates a true mountain experience.

Can I choose whether to do a day trek or a multi-day trek?
Yes, the guide will work with you to plan an itinerary that suits your time frame and interests, whether you prefer a short day hike or a longer adventure.
Are meals included in the tour price?
The tour fee covers the guide’s lunch and dinner, but your personal meals are not included. You can stop at local restaurants for meals, which you pay for directly.
Is transportation included?
Private transportation can be organized upon request, but it is not included in the standard price. You can coordinate this with your guide if needed.
What’s the maximum group size?
Up to 15 people, making it intimate enough for personalized attention but still social.
How fit do I need to be?
A moderate level of physical fitness is recommended. The routes are designed to be manageable, but some walking over varied terrain is involved.
What if the weather turns bad?
The experience requires good weather. If canceled due to poor weather, you’ll be offered a different date or a full refund.
